Elevate your weeknight meals with this quick and vibrant Pea Shoots Stir Fry, or "Chow Dau Miu," a classic Cantonese dish that highlights the natural sweetness and delicate texture of fresh pea shoots. In just 15 minutes, you'll create a nutrient-packed side dish infused with the earthy aroma of garlic, a touch of umami from chicken stock, and the subtle nuttiness of sesame oil. This simple yet elegant recipe requires minimal ingredients, making it an ideal choice for those seeking a healthy and flavorful addition to their dinner table. Serve this stir-fry alongside steamed rice or as a refreshing accompaniment to your favorite main dishes for a truly satisfying meal. 🥘 Ingredients

7 items
  • 400 grams Fresh pea shoots
  • 4 pieces Garlic cloves
  • 2 tablespoons Vegetable oil
  • 0.5 teaspoons Salt
  • 0.25 teaspoons Sugar
  • 2 tablespoons Chicken stock
  • 0.5 teaspoons Sesame oil

📝 Instructions

10 steps
1

Wash the pea shoots thoroughly under cold water to remove any dirt or debris. Drain and set aside.

2

Peel and finely chop the garlic cloves.

3

In a large wok or skillet, heat the vegetable oil over medium-high heat.

4

Add the chopped garlic and stir-fry for about 30 seconds until fragrant, but do not let it burn.

5

Increase the heat to high and add the pea shoots to the wok. Use a spatula or tongs to toss and stir constantly.

6

Sprinkle the salt and sugar over the pea shoots and mix well.

7

Add the chicken stock and continue to stir-fry for 1–2 minutes, or until the pea shoots are just tender and wilted.

8

Drizzle the sesame oil over the stir-fried pea shoots and toss to coat evenly.

9

Remove the wok from heat and transfer the cooked pea shoots to a serving plate.

10

Serve immediately as a side dish or alongside steamed rice.
